If I turn flash on, the video plays fine. So I'll repeat:
To test, please click here:
http://www.adobe.com/software/flash/about/
That should check your version and respond with:
You have version 10,0,45,2 installed
It that still has issues, then I recommend that you try a different
Firefox profile to test and see if the problem is with your profile. You
can do this by renaming /home/<username>/.mozilla/firefox to something
like /home/<username>/.mozilla/x-firefox-x and then reopen firefox to
test. You can always move this back if you find the problem is with the
profile.
Alternately, you can start firefox with the profile manager and create a
new test profile:
$ firefox -P
